Home | History | Annotate | Download | only in Checkers

Lines Matching refs:strLength

104                                               SVal strLength);
590 SVal strLength) {
591 assert(!strLength.isUndef() && "Attempt to set an undefined string length");
622 if (strLength.isUnknown())
625 return state->set<CStringLength>(MR, strLength);
644 SVal strLength = svalBuilder.getMetadataSymbolVal(CStringChecker::getTag(),
648 state = state->set<CStringLength>(MR, strLength);
650 return strLength;
1090 SVal strLength = getCStringLength(C, state, Arg, ArgVal);
1094 if (strLength.isUndef())
1109 NonLoc *strLengthNL = dyn_cast<NonLoc>(&strLength);
1115 // Check if the strLength is greater than the maxlen.
1160 result = cast<DefinedOrUnknownSVal>(strLength);
1238 SVal strLength = getCStringLength(C, state, srcExpr, srcVal);
1241 if (strLength.isUndef())
1264 NonLoc *strLengthNL = dyn_cast<NonLoc>(&strLength);
1282 // strLength copied is the max number arg.
1289 amountCopied = strLength;
1366 amountCopied = strLength;
1498 if (amountCopied != strLength)
1743 DefinedOrUnknownSVal strLength
1746 state = state->set<CStringLength>(MR, strLength);